"The Porsche 911 (996) replaced the 993 in 1997 and was made available with a series of water-cooled flat-six engines from Porsche instead of the air-cooled engines of previous 911 generations. Also notable for the 996 was its new body shell, which was no longer based on Ferdinand Porsche's original design. It was also significantly increased in size to improve driving comfort. The Carrera RS model was dropped for this generation."@en . . .
